Intelliconnect is a leading manufacturer of coaxial RF connectors, adaptors, and cable assemblies, supplying products to market sectors such as Aerospace & Defence, Medical, Industrial and Cryogenics. Intelliconnect is a rapidly growing business with an ambitious plan for future growth and investment.
The Operations Manager is responsible for leading and managing all operational activities to ensure the business consistently delivers customer requirements safely, efficiently, and profitably. The role is accountable for achieving operational objectives relating to quality, cost, delivery, productivity, and continuous improvement while ensuring compliance with company and industry standards.
The Operations Manager will define and implement operational strategy, oversee production planning and execution, and ensure all products are delivered On Time In Full (OTIF) and within agreed commercial targets and quality expectations. The role also ensures equipment, processes, people, and supply chain activities are aligned to support business performance and growth. A key part of the role is developing a high-performing operational culture focused on accountability, continuous improvement, customer satisfaction, and employee engagement.

Job Responsibilities
Compliance, Quality & Health and Safety:
- Ensure the business maintains compliance with ISO 9001, ISO 14001, ISO 45001, and SC21 and AS9100 standards by:
- Promoting and maintaining a safe working environment for employees, contractors, visitors, and customers.
- Ensuring all accidents, incidents, near misses, and unsafe conditions are reported and investigated appropriately.
- Driving a culture focused on achieving zero Lost Time Incidents (LTI’s).
- Ensuring all operational procedures, processes, and documentation remain current, controlled, and fully compliant.
- Managing non-conformances effectively, ensuring root cause analysis and corrective actions are implemented in a timely manner.
- Ensuring training plans, competency matrices, and operating standards are maintained and adhered to across the department.
Operations & Production Management:
- Lead day-to-day operational activities to ensure customer requirements are achieved safely, efficiently, and profitably.
- Ensure production plans are effectively managed and resources are aligned to meet customer delivery requirements.
- Ensure all products are delivered On Time In Full (OTIF), to required quality standards and agreed commercial targets.
- Ensure materials, labour, equipment, and operational capability are available to support production schedules.
- Monitor operational performance and take proactive action to address risks, delays, or inefficiencies.
- Ensure equipment is maintained, operational downtime is minimised, and asset care processes are consistently applied.
- Support the introduction of new products, operational changes, and process improvements.
- Recommend and support capital investment initiatives to improve operational capability and efficiency.
